The anticipated data for 2024 marks Spain as the leader in environmental protection-related ancillary output in waste management within the fabricated metal products sector, standing at €17.7 million. Austria and Belgium follow with €11.1 million and €7.7 million, respectively. Notably, Spain's year-on-year growth of 0.81% in 2023 highlights steady performance, while Austria saw a higher growth of 2.11%. Belgium experienced a significant increase of 6.2%, whereas Portugal and Slovakia faced declines of -2.03% and -4.9%, respectively. Slovenia showed positive growth with a 5.92% rise, while Finland remained stable with no change.

Top countries in Environmental Protection Related Ancillary Output in Waste Management in Manufacture of Fabricated Metal Products (Except Machinery and Equipment) by the Business Sector by Country
| # | 7 Countries | Million Euros | Last Year | YoY | 5-years CAGR |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| 1 Spain | 17.7 | 2023 | +1.72% | +0.81% | View data |
| 2 | 2 Austria | 11.1 | 2023 | +1.83% | +2.11% | View data |
| 3 | 3 Belgium | 7.7 | 2023 | +5.48% | +6.2% | View data |
| 4 | 4 Portugal | 3.7 | 2023 | 0% | -2.03% | View data |
| 5 | 5 Slovakia | 0.7 | 2023 | -12.5% | -4.9% | View data |
| 6 | 6 Slovenia | 0.4 | 2023 | 0% | +5.92% | View data |
| 7 | 7 Finland | 0.3 | 2023 | 0% | 0% | View data |
